Understanding Quality vs. Cost

One of the most significant pain points when selecting an LED working light manufacturer is balancing quality with cost. Many customers fall into the trap of opting for the cheapest option, only to find that the product does not meet their expectations or safety standards.

For instance, a construction company based in Texas reported purchasing low-cost LED lights to save money for their project. They soon experienced malfunctioning lights, leading to decreased productivity and increased replacement costs. In contrast, investing in a reputable manufacturer provided durability, reducing replacement frequency and ultimately saving money.

Determining the Right Specifications

Another common issue is understanding the technical specifications. Terms like lumen output, color temperature, and power consumption can be daunting for buyers without a technical background. Here are some simple explanations:

  • Lumen Output: This measures the brightness of the light. For optimal visibility on job sites, look for LED lights with at least 2,500 lumens.
  • Color Temperature: Measured in Kelvin (K), this indicates the light's color. A color temperature of around 5,000K provides a natural daylight effect, ideal for working environments.
  • Power Consumption: This refers to how much energy the light uses. Lower consumption means lower electricity costs, so look for LEDs with a power rating that suits your needs.

By familiarizing yourself with these terms, you’ll be better equipped to assess different manufacturers’ products and choose one that meets your needs.

After-Sales Support and Warranty

Many customers overlook the importance of after-sales support and warranties. A product may look great on paper, but how a company handles issues after the sale can be a game-changer. Check for warranties that offer at least two to five years of coverage. Additionally, reliable customer service ensures that should any issues arise, you have the necessary support to resolve them quickly.

A manufacturing plant in Ohio faced issues with malfunctioning lights shortly after installation. They discovered that their manufacturer offered an outstanding customer service hotline and a five-year warranty, allowing them to swiftly replace the faulty units without incurring additional costs.
